Projectile Excitations in p(p,n)Nπ Reactions
Abstract
It has recently been proven from measurements of the spin-transfer coefficients Dxx and Dzz that there is a small but non-vanishing S=0 component σ0, in the inclusive p(p,n)Nπ\, reaction cross section σ\,. It is shown that the dominant part of the measured σ0 can be explained in terms of the projectile excitation mechanism. An estimate is further made of contributions to σ0 from s-wave rescattering process. It is found that s-wave rescattering contribution is much smaller than the contribution coming from projectile excitation mechanism. The addition of s-wave rescattering contribution to the dominant part, however, improves the fit to the data.
